Company Overview:
MTLAB is an R&D company based in Dubai, developing the world’s first AI for shopping that unifies both online and offline experiences. By integrating chat-to-shop, social shopping, virtual try-ons, and proximity offers, our AI provides a superior experience for shoppers and boosts sales for businesses.
Role Summary:
We are looking for a highly skilled and motivated Frontend Developer specializing in React to join our team. You will be responsible for implementing the visual elements that users see and interact with in our AI-driven web applications. You will collaborate closely with designers, backend developers, and AI specialists to create intuitive and seamless user experiences that elevate the functionality and performance of our applications.
Responsibilities:
• Develop and maintain frontend features using React.
• Build reusable components and libraries for future use.
• Translate designs and wireframes into high-quality code.
• Collaborate with backend and AI teams to integrate APIs and AI functionalities.
• Ensure the technical feasibility of UI/UX designs.
• Optimize performance for speed and scalability.
• Ensure cross-browser compatibility and responsiveness.
• Debug and resolve frontend issues.
Requirements:
• 5+ years of experience in frontend development, with a strong focus on React.
• In-depth understanding of React.js and its core principles.
• Experience with React.js workflows (Flux or Redux).
• Proficiency in JavaScript and understanding of the JavaScript object model.
• Experience with RESTful APIs and modern authorization mechanisms (e.g., JSON Web Token).
• Familiarity with front-end development tools (e.g., Babel, Webpack, NPM).
• Experience with version control (Git) and CI/CD pipelines.
• Experience with AI integration is a plus.
• Strong understanding of responsive design and cross-browser compatibility.
• Excellent problem-solving skills and attention to detail.
Why MTLAB?
• Work with a world-class team, setting new benchmarks.
• Tackle global-scale, non-trivial challenges.
• Grow with unparalleled learning and advancement opportunities.
• Experience rapid career progression.
• Receive a competitive compensation package.
• Opportunity for equity stake.
===
O компании:
MTLAB - это научно-исследовательская компания из Дубая, создающая первый в мире ИИ для шопинга, объединяющий онлайн- и офлайн- пространство. Интегрируя чат, покупки, социальный шопинг, виртуальную примерку и предложения по геолокации, наш ИИ обеспечивает лучший пользовательский опыт и повышает продажи для брендов.
Краткое описание вакансии:
Мы ищем высококвалифицированного и мотивированного фронтенд-разработчика, специализирующегося на React, для работы в нашей команде. Вы будете отвечать за реализацию визуальных элементов, которые пользователи видят и с которыми взаимодействуют в наших веб-приложениях на основе ИИ. Вы будете тесно сотрудничать с дизайнерами, бэкенд-разработчиками и специалистами по ИИ для создания интуитивно понятного и удобного пользовательского интерфейса.
Обязанности:
• Разработка и поддержка функций фронтенда с использованием React.
• Создание повторно используемых компонентов и библиотек для будущего использования.
• Преобразование проектов и каркасов в высококачественный код.
• Взаимодействие с бэкенд-разработчиками и командами ИИ для интеграции API и функций ИИ.
• Обеспечение технической осуществимости UI/UX-дизайна.
• Оптимизация производительности для скорости и масштабируемости.
• Обеспечение кроссбраузерной совместимости и отзывчивости.
• Отладка и решение проблем фронтенда.
Требования:
• Более 5 лет опыта фронтенд-разработки с акцентом на React.
• Глубокое понимание React.js и его основных принципов.
• Опыт работы с рабочими процессами React.js (Flux или Redux).
• Профессиональное владение JavaScript и понимание объектной модели JavaScript.
• Опыт работы с RESTful API и современными механизмами авторизации (например, JSON Web Token).
• Знакомство с инструментами фронтенд-разработки (например, Babel, Webpack, NPM).
• Опыт работы с системами контроля версий (Git) и конвейерами CI/CD.
• Опыт интеграции с ИИ будет плюсом.
• Глубокое понимание принципов адаптивного дизайна и кроссбраузерной совместимости.
• Отличные навыки решения проблем и внимание к деталям.
Почему MTLAB?
• Возможность создать продукт мирового уровня вместе с сильной командой
• Работа над нетривиальными задачами в глобальном масштабе
• Уникальные возможности для профессионального роста и обучения
• Быстрое карьерный рост
• Конкурентный компенсационный пакет
• Возможность получения доли в компании (equity)